Esperion Therapeutics reported a Q1 2026 EPS of -$0.10, missing the consensus estimate of -$0.0342 by a wide margin of -192.4%. The company did not report any revenue for the quarter, consistent with its pre-commercial status in the lipid-lowering therapy space. The stock price was unchanged following the announcement, suggesting the miss may have been partially anticipated or overshadowed by other factors.

Esperion’s Q1 2026 results highlight the continued costs of advancing its pipeline of non-statin, LDL-cholesterol-lowering therapies. The wider-than-expected loss—$0.10 per share versus the -$0.0342 estimate—likely reflects increased R&D spending on ongoing clinical trials for bempedoic acid combinations and other pipeline candidates. Without any recorded revenue, the company remains wholly dependent on its cash reserves and potential partnership income to fund operations. Operational highlights during the quarter may have included progress on regulatory submissions or enrollment updates for key studies, though no specific milestones were reported alongside the earnings release. The loss per share was roughly three times greater than analysts modeled, underscoring the challenges of forecasting expenses for a late-stage development firm. Investors are likely to watch for updates on the company’s cash burn rate and any expense mitigation strategies. Additionally, the lack of revenue surprises suggests Esperion has not yet secured new commercial partnerships or licensing agreements in the period, leaving all forward progress tied to clinical and regulatory achievements.

Management did not provide specific financial guidance for the remainder of 2026, but based on the reported EPS miss, the company may need to reassess its spending plans to preserve cash. Esperion anticipates that upcoming milestones—such as potential FDA decisions or data readouts from Phase 3 trials—could serve as catalysts for business development activities. The strategic priority remains advancing bempedoic acid and its combination therapies to new markets, particularly for patients with statin intolerance or high cardiovascular risk. However, the wider-than-expected loss may prompt greater scrutiny of operating expenses, including R&D allocation and general administrative costs. Risk factors include the possibility of delayed regulatory reviews, competitive pressure from established PCSK9 inhibitors, and the need for additional financing if clinical timelines extend. The company’s ability to execute on its development plans while managing its burn rate will be critical in the near term.

The stock’s unchanged reaction to a significant EPS miss suggests that the market may be looking past near-term losses and focusing on the upcoming pipeline catalysts. Analysts may view the Q1 2026 earnings as less impactful for a pre-revenue biotech, especially if the miss was driven by one-time trial costs. However, the magnitude of the surprise—nearly triple the expected loss—could lead some analysts to adjust their models and pose questions about expense control on the next conference call. Key events to watch in the coming quarters include any FDA regulatory decisions, partnership announcements, or new clinical data that could validate Esperion’s therapeutic platform. Without revenue, the company’s valuation hinges almost entirely on the probability of future commercialization success. Investors should monitor the cash position and any forward guidance on operating expenses to assess how long the current runway can sustain operations without dilutive financing.
